Naches Ranger District
From the town of Naches, all the way up to White Pass, the Naches Ranger District encompasses approximately 518,000 acres of recreation opportunities. Get epic views of Mt. Rainier while also experiencing over 200 days of sunshine per year.
Here, in a still largely unknown part of Washington, visitors will find plenty of opportunities for camping, swimming, hiking, rock climbing, off-roading, fishing and more.
With rambling roads, breathtaking vistas, and plenty of pit stops, the White Pass Scenic Byway is a great place to begin. Climbers will find over 700 climbing routes on basalt columns overlooking the Tieton River. Clear Lake and Rimrock are just a few popular spots for boating. Divide Ridge near Naches is popular with four-wheel drive enthusiasts and offers trails that are both scenic and challenging.
Adjacent to other swaths of wilderness, visiting the Naches Ranger District also gives you access to Goat Rocks Wilderness, Norse Peak, Mt. Rainier, Gifford-Pinchot National Forest and more!
